Output 07d5cf691c996d514b67f528c83ddb7eb28e39dc5eda1a31b02ce37fd6a138e5:0

value
14333167
script pubkey
OP_0 OP_PUSHBYTES_20 5376001a57cfa7f497268109156958b18ee05aba
address
bc1q2dmqqxjhe7nlf9exsyy3262ckx8wqk463hyj8h
transaction
07d5cf691c996d514b67f528c83ddb7eb28e39dc5eda1a31b02ce37fd6a138e5
confirmations
108328
spent
true